Frequently Asked Questions about Northwest Kansas City

How much are Studio apartments in Northwest Kansas City?

There are currently 26 Studio Apartments in Northwest Kansas City with rent ranges from $1,050 to $1,155 with an average price of $1,109.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Northwest Kansas City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Northwest Kansas City ranges from $735 to $1,620 with an average monthly rent of $1,180.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Northwest Kansas City c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Northwest Kansas City range from $800 to $1,700.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,134.

How expensive are Northwest Kansas City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 17 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Northwest Kansas City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,199 to $1,725 - averaging $1,417 for the location.
